#064198 Hex Color Code

#064198

The Hexadecimal Color #064198 is a contrast shade of Midnight Blue. #064198 RGB value is rgb(6, 65, 152). RGB Color Model of #064198 consists of 2% red, 25% green and 59% blue. HSL color Mode of #064198 has 216°(degrees) Hue, 92% Saturation and 31% Lightness. #064198 color has an wavelength of 484n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#064198 is #336699.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#064198 is #049. The Closest Color to #064198 is #191970. Official Name of #064198 Hex Code is Congress Blue.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#064198 is 96 Cyan 57 Magenta 0 Yellow 40 Black and #064198 CMY is 96, 57,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#064198 is hsl(216,92,31,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(216, 96, 60).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#064198 is 7.63, 6.09, 30.47.
Hex8 Value of #064198 is #064198FF. Decimal Value of #064198 is 410008 and Octal Value of #064198 is 1440630. Binary Value of #064198 is 110, 1000001, 10011000 and Android of #064198 is 4278600088 / 0xff064198.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#064198 is 0.173, 0.138, 0.138 and YIQ Color Space of #064198 is 57.277, -63.1112, 14.5959.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#064198 is 3.26, 5.16, 30.07.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#064198 is 29.64, 18.97, -52.13.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#064198 is 29.64, -14.46, -69.53.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#064198 is 29.64, 55.47, 290.0. Hunter Lab variable of #064198 is 24.68, 12.0, -55.93.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#064198

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
